Side-by-side financial comparison of Coeur Mining, Inc. (CDE) and Krispy Kreme, Inc. (DNUT). Click either name above to swap in a different company.

Coeur Mining, Inc. is the larger business by last-quarter revenue ($674.8M vs $392.4M, roughly 1.7× Krispy Kreme, Inc.). Coeur Mining, Inc. runs the higher net margin — 31.9% vs -7.1%, a 38.9% gap on every dollar of revenue. On growth, Coeur Mining, Inc. posted the faster year-over-year revenue change (120.9% vs -2.9%). Coeur Mining, Inc. produced more free cash flow last quarter ($313.3M vs $27.9M). Over the past eight quarters, Coeur Mining, Inc.'s revenue compounded faster (78.0% CAGR vs -5.9%).

Coeur Mining, Inc. is a precious metals mining company listed on the New York Stock exchange. It operates five mines located in North America. Coeur employs 2,200 people and in 2012 it was the world's 9th largest silver producer. In 2013 the company changed its name to Coeur Mining, Inc. from Coeur d'Alene Mines and moved its head office to Chicago, Illinois from Coeur d'Alene, Idaho.

Krispy Kreme, Inc. is an American multinational doughnut company and coffeehouse chain. Krispy Kreme was founded by Vernon Rudolph (1915–1973), who bought a yeast-raised recipe from a New Orleans chef, rented a building in 1937 in what is now historic Old Salem in Winston-Salem, North Carolina, and began selling to local grocery stores.
